The Rewards and Challenges of Prospectus Writing

Hear about the process of putting together a prospectus from students who are various stages of the writing process, and from those who have recently defended their prospectuses. Students are writing both book and 3-article form dissertations. A faculty member will also share their thoughts on the different forms a prospectus may take, the many functions a prospectus serves, and the benefits and consequences of different kinds of prospectuses.
